Fitness February: Intermediate/Advanced
  • Pilates with Lucy Lowndes | Elastic Band

    All the exercises in this class can be taken either with an elastic band or without. Make sure you have a mat or something soft to lie on.

    This class is taught by ENB Associate Artist Lucy Lowndes, with ENB YouthCo dancer Samuel Larsen demonstrating and music by Domenico Angarano.

  • Dance Cardio with Julia Conway | Upper Body

    Work on your cardio, upper body and abdominals in this dance fitness class from ENB First Soloist and certified Pilates instructor Julia Conway.

    Please use a mat when following the class, and feel free to use the modifications provided throughout the class.

  • Intermediate Dynamic Control with James Muller

    This short ballet class include barre and centre practice, with a focus on dynamic control.

    James Muller leads this session while Chris Swithinbank accompanies on piano.

  • Ballet with Kate Hartley-Stevens: Le Corsaire (Advanced)

    Dance to the music of this thrilling ballet about pirates at the barre, and in the centre learn an excerpt of the Villagers' Dance in Act 1.

    Kate Hartley-Stevens leads this stand-alone class, with Emily Suzuki, Junior Soloist of English National Ballet, demonstrating and Reina Okada accompanying...

  • Ballet with Crystal Costa | 7 (Advanced)

    This class is all about preparing for grand allegro in a small space, working on coordination and strengthening the legs.

    Crystal Costa, former First Soloist with English National Ballet, leads this ballet course for Intermediate to Advanced dancers to get back in the studio and back on stage.
